Transaction 93df3d5906e2c372773352cd7e3f9c32bcddcb20a44e465016051fad5c2e25d3

1 Input
2 Outputs
  • 93df3d5906e2c372773352cd7e3f9c32bcddcb20a44e465016051fad5c2e25d3:0
  • value  9267988
    address  352GWWKCf6MD3HPRYpocFvQDDcfvorm15N
  • 93df3d5906e2c372773352cd7e3f9c32bcddcb20a44e465016051fad5c2e25d3:1
  • value  105434745
    address  1Jo8Lutv2sX2ayabV4hT9TubdrW2FkTnhu